2. Hotpoint HCO390
Originally an affiliate of General Electric (USA), Hotpoint is now part of the European company Indesit. The name Hotpoint is also used for a range of other appliances for the home, such as washing machines and refrigerators.
The brand was established in 1911. The brand has a fascinating origin story. The name comes from the original Hotpoint Iron, which was designed by Earl Richardson and reputedly the first electric iron with central heating. It also featured an automatic shutoff.
